Determination of the in Vivo Stoichiometry of Tyrosyl Radical per ββ′ in Saccharomyces cerevisiae Ribonucleotide Reductase()

The class I ribonucleotide reductases catalyze the conversion of nucleotides to deoxynucleotides and are composed of two subunits: R1 and R2.
